    Founded in 2015, the leadership program aims to increase the representation of women in leadership roles in science fields. Homeward Bound participants go through a twelve month training program that is focused on the topic of climate change and concludes with a three-week expedition to Antarctica.     The housing movement in New York City was noted in this era for the prevalence of women in leadership, including at the Met Council; [6] in addition to Jane Benedict, other founders included Esther T. Rand [7] and Frances Goldin, [1] and other women in leadership roles early in the organization's existence included Mrs. Juan Sanchez [8] and Marie Runyon. [1]
